Why Do Fort Worth HVAC Companies Struggle to Rank on Google?
Most HVAC websites in Fort Worth suffer from the same handful of problems: thin service pages that say almost nothing, no local content tied to real neighborhoods, and a Google Business Profile that hasn’t been touched since it was first created. Google’s algorithm rewards relevance and authority — and a five-page website with generic copy signals neither.
Fort Worth’s unique climate adds another layer of urgency. Summers regularly push past 100°F, and winters occasionally deliver hard freezes — the kind that caused widespread pipe and HVAC damage during Winter Storm Uri in February 2021. That seasonal whiplash means homeowners are searching frantically at peak moments. If your site isn’t already ranking before those spikes hit, you won’t appear in time to capture the surge.
The Google Map Pack Problem
The three-pack of local business listings at the top of Google search results captures the majority of clicks for high-intent searches like “HVAC company Fort Worth” or “furnace repair Benbrook.” Most clicks never make it past those three businesses. If you’re not in the map pack, you’re invisible to the buyers who are ready to schedule right now.
Earning a map pack position requires a well-optimized Google Business Profile, consistent NAP (name, address, phone) citations across the web, genuine customer reviews, and a website that supports your local relevance signals. That’s a system — not a one-time fix.
What Does a Strong Local SEO Strategy Look Like for Fort Worth HVAC?
Effective seo services Fort Worth HVAC companies need go well beyond basic keyword stuffing. Here’s what a real strategy covers.
Neighborhood-Level Service Pages
Fort Worth is a big city with distinct communities. A page titled “AC Repair in Fort Worth” competes with every other HVAC company in the area. Pages built around specific neighborhoods — Wedgwood, TCU/Westcliff, Summerfields, or the medical district near Cook Children’s — give you a precision advantage. Google can match your page to a searcher’s exact location, and competitors who haven’t done this work simply can’t compete at that level.
Google Business Profile Optimization
Your GBP listing is often the first thing a potential customer sees. An optimized profile includes accurate service categories, a keyword-rich business description, up-to-date service areas covering communities like Lake Worth, Saginaw, and White Settlement, and a steady stream of fresh photos and Google Posts. Review management — actively requesting reviews and responding to them — signals to Google that you’re an active, trusted business.
Technical Site Health
A slow-loading, mobile-unfriendly HVAC site will not rank well, no matter how good the content is. Page speed, Core Web Vitals, HTTPS security, and clean site architecture all factor into Google’s ranking signals. When a homeowner’s AC goes out at 9 PM and they’re searching on their phone, your site needs to load in under three seconds or they’re already gone.
Content That Answers Real Questions
Fort Worth homeowners ask specific questions: “How often should I change my air filter in Texas heat?” or “What’s the average cost of a new AC unit in Tarrant County?” Blog content and FAQ sections that answer these questions credibly build topical authority — Google’s way of recognizing that your site genuinely knows HVAC. That authority flows to your money pages and helps them rank.
How Long Does SEO Take for an HVAC Company in Fort Worth?
Honest answer: most HVAC companies begin seeing meaningful movement in Google rankings within three to six months of starting a well-executed campaign. Map pack improvements for moderately competitive terms can come sooner — sometimes within six to ten weeks of a GBP overhaul and citation cleanup. Highly competitive keywords like “HVAC company Fort Worth” take longer, but the compounding return is worth it: unlike paid ads, organic rankings keep delivering without a cost-per-click attached to every call.

How Fort Worth’s Growth Creates SEO Opportunities Right Now
Fort Worth is one of the fastest-growing large cities in the United States. New residential developments in areas like Walsh Ranch in western Fort Worth and the ongoing expansion along the Alliance Corridor in the north bring thousands of new homeowners into the market every year. New construction means new HVAC installs, warranty service calls, and customers who haven’t yet established loyalty to any local company.
HVAC companies that invest in SEO now will own the search real estate in these emerging neighborhoods before the competition catches up. Waiting means someone else claims that ground first, and dislodging an entrenched competitor from the map pack takes significantly more effort than building a position from scratch in a newer market.
Nearby cities like Arlington, Burleson, Azle, and Weatherford also present ranking opportunities for Fort Worth-based HVAC companies willing to expand their service area targeting. A well-structured local SEO campaign can build visibility across the entire western Tarrant County region — not just inside the Fort Worth city limits.

Frequently Asked Questions: SEO for HVAC Companies in Fort Worth
What is the most important SEO factor for HVAC companies in Fort Worth?
Google Business Profile optimization combined with consistent customer reviews is typically the highest-leverage starting point for Fort Worth HVAC companies. A well-maintained GBP directly influences map pack visibility, which drives the majority of local service calls.
How much does SEO cost for an HVAC company in Fort Worth, Texas?
Local SEO campaigns for HVAC contractors in Fort Worth typically range from a few hundred to several thousand dollars per month depending on the scope — number of service areas, competition level, content volume, and whether technical work is needed. Most companies find the return on investment significantly exceeds the cost once rankings are established.
Can SEO help my HVAC company get more calls during peak season in Fort Worth?
Yes, but SEO needs to be built before peak season hits. Fort Worth’s summer heat drives massive search volume in June through August. Rankings take time to establish, so companies that start their SEO campaigns in winter or early spring are positioned to capture that summer surge rather than scrambling to catch up after it begins.
Do I need separate pages for each neighborhood in Fort Worth?
For competitive HVAC markets like Fort Worth, yes — neighborhood-specific service pages significantly improve your chances of ranking for hyper-local searches. Pages targeting Wedgwood, Fossil Creek, Hulen Bend, and other distinct communities help Google match your business to searchers in those exact areas.
How do online reviews affect my HVAC company’s search rankings in Fort Worth?
Reviews are a direct ranking signal for local search results, particularly for map pack placement. The quantity, recency, and quality of your Google reviews all influence where you appear. HVAC companies in Fort Worth should have a systematic process for asking satisfied customers to leave a review after every completed job.
Is SEO better than Google Ads for Fort Worth HVAC companies?
They serve different purposes. Google Ads delivers immediate visibility and calls but stops the moment you stop paying. SEO builds compounding organic authority that generates calls without a cost-per-click. Most successful Fort Worth HVAC companies use both — ads to cover the gaps while SEO builds momentum, then rely more heavily on organic rankings long-term.
